ROGERSVILLE, Mo. — The Carthage Tigers split a pair of non-conference games on Saturday at Logan-Rogersville High School.
Carthage beat Rogersville 17-0 in four innings and the Tigers suffered a 7-2 loss to Camdenton.
Against Rogersville, Carthage scored eight runs in the first inning, six in the third and three more in the fourth.
Jenna Calhoon drove in four runs on three hits, including a homer, while
Ashlyn Brust and
Alexis Smith had two hits and two RBI apiece.
Aven Willis and Brust scored three runs apiece, while Calhoon,
Landry Cochran,
Lexa Youngblood, Smith and
Shelby Hegwer all scored two runs apiece.
Camdenton defeated Carthage 7-2.
The Tigers managed single tallies in the first and fourth innings. Carthage had five hits, one apiece by Brust, Calhoon, Youngblood,
Avery Smith and
Brooklyn Dolon-Main.
Addison Wallace went 6 1/3 innings in the circle, allowing seven runs on 12 hits with four strikeouts.
Ashlynn Jackson recorded two outs, striking out one.
Camdenton's Cayden VonSande was the winning pitcher. She struck out 11 and walked three in seven frames.
Carthage (12-12) is at Nevada at 5 on Monday night.
